Onions was my first guess as to the wrong ingredient. Though I've never made them, I'll pass on a recipe for pickled beets. Beets, vinegar, beet juice (from when you boil them), sugar, salt and pickling spice. I'm envious. I find it difficult-nay impossible to get fresh beets where I live in Japan. Enjoy!
